Minn. drownings at a 10-year high
Minnesota drownings are at a 10-year high, according to a state report released last week.
On Saturday, a 6-year-old boy drowned in Golden Valley, marking the sixth drowning in Hennepin County this year. Statewide, more than 25 people have drowned in non-boating incidents so far this year.
We'll look at the possible reasons for the spike in deaths and what is being down to prevent drownings.
